what does atomic number of an element represent.

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 02-02-2018
The number of protons in an atomic nucleus; it indicates the position of an element in the periodic table. The number of protons in the nucleus of an atom. Inelectrically neutral atoms, this number is also equal to the number of electrons orbiting about the atom's nucleus.
